In the most recent company report the AAC NTA is quoted as $1.75, at that level the current share price is still a healthy discount even after the rise on 6th Sep.
Is it possible that the current NTA is under valued? given the dramatic rise in the price of farmland? I think the price of livestock has also risen. However as AAC have approx 7m ha of land that will dwarf the value of 350k cattle.
Could this be the driver of share price rise now and in the future, or am I overlooking something?. On paper it seems to be incredible that a company that owns so much land is worth less than a very small tech startup with no assets at all.
